| Aspect | Computer Science Education | Computer Science Teacher |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Typically requires a degree in computer science or education, often with certification in teaching | Requires a degree in computer science or related field, plus teaching certification |
| Work Environment | Educational institutions, online platforms, training programs | Schools, colleges, educational institutions |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Educational organizations, edtech companies, training providers | Primary schools, high schools, colleges |
| Common Search & Comparison | Focuses on curriculum development, programming skills, and educational methods | Focuses on classroom teaching, lesson planning, and student assessment |
Computer Science Education generally refers to designing and delivering computer science curricula, often involving curriculum development and educational strategies. In contrast, a Computer Science Teacher primarily focuses on instructing students in computer science concepts within a classroom setting. Both roles require similar credentials but differ in their scope and work environment.

Q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S: To qualify for this position, you must meet the qualification requirements outlined below:
BASIC REQUIREMENTS All GRADES: A bachelor's degree in computer science or bachelor's degree with 30 semester hours in a combination of mathematics, statistics, and computer science. At least 15 of the 30 semester hours must have included any combination of statistics and mathematics that included differential and integral calculus. All academic degrees and course work must be from accredited or pre-accredited institutions.
Evaluation of Education:
Applicants should have sufficient knowledge to understand the fundamental concepts and techniques of computer science. Courses designed to provide an introduction to computer science techniques and methodologies, to problems of system design, and to other specialized fields are acceptable. Courses or experience in teaching elementary, business, or shop mathematics are not acceptable.

SPECIALIZED EXPERIENCE GS-14: In addition to meeting basic requirements, to be eligible for this position at this grade level, you must have one (1) year of specialized experience at a level of difficulty and responsibility equivalent to the GS-13 grade level in the Federal service.
Specialized experience for this position includes:
- Demonstrated professional competence in applying the theoretical foundations of computer science, including the design, development and application of computer systems and architectures, artificial intelligence, natural language processing, deep learning, data ingestion, normalization, and ontologies.
- Applying software exploitation techniques, cryptanalysis, or blockchain technology.
- Interpreting and applying relevant mathematical and statistical sciences.
- Working complex assignments in research, acquisition, design, development and maintenance of information systems for identifying and tracing movements in cryptocurrency, deanonymization of online actors, identifying suspicious activity, or analyzing and organizing large volumes of unstructured data.
- Leading projects to design, acquire, and implement major prototype and developmental systems.
- Making extensive modifications and upgrades to existing systems, taking into account changing requirements and interfaces, advances in technology, and evolving standards.
